warwick. p 1 UK Work Permits Kim Vowden University of Warwick MBA Programme 4th October 2000

warwick. p 2 Summary Who needs permission to work in the UK? Working in the UK as a student Work permits Setting up a business in the UK Family members

warwick. p 3 Who needs permission to work in the UK? People who don’t need permission include: British citizens and other EEA nationals People with indefinite leave to remain Commonwealth citizens with UK ancestry Spouses and unmarried partners of people in these and other long stay categories (eg. work permit holders)

warwick. p 4 Working in the UK as a student Students can work subject to the following conditions: maximum 20 hours per week during term time except where placement is necessary part of studies as agreed by educational institution no limit on hours during holidays cannot engage in business, self-employment, professional sport/entertainment must not fill a permanent full-time vacancy

warwick. p 5 Work permit scheme Criteria for full work permit Degree Resident labour test: recruitment search, eg. advertising, headhunt OR request waiver, eg. milkround search, unique skills OR tier 1 application exempt from resident labour test, eg. intracompany transfer, board level post, shortage occupation

warwick. p 6 Work permit Scheme Training and Work Experience Scheme (TWES) Work experience

warwick. p 7 Work permit scheme Procedure Employer applies to Department for Education and Employment in Sheffield Processing time: 1 day to 4 weeks Out of country/ in country applications Full work permit valid for up to 4 years (5 years from 1st November 2000). After 4 years individual can apply for indefinite leave to remain Permit valid for specified job with specified employer

warwick. p 8 Self-employed/business person Individual must invest £200,000 of his or her own money into proposed or existing UK business and have controlling or equal interest in the business Must create at least 2 full time jobs for UK residents Entry clearance Permission to stay in UK for 1 year - can renew for a further 3 years and apply for indefinite leave to remain after 4 years EC Association Agreements

warwick. p 9 Innovator New category - introduced 4th September 2000 No need for £200,000 investment or controlling interest (minimum 5% shareholding) Points system for rating individual, business plan and benefits to UK Entry clearance Permission to stay in UK for 1 year - can renew for further 3 years and apply for indefinite leave to remain after 4 years

warwick. p 10 Family members Spouse/ unmarried partner/ children Entry clearance No restriction on employment
